Output 57f6dedf89f968c1a01a03e58ed93226f4b689f6c7782128d65c8fd8892dcd17:1

value
182305370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cc15cb37d0983edb420c5a4df2582545b4eaafd OP_EQUALVERIFY OP_CHECKSIG
address
1FHr3xiwQuyUV3pzcJqQmLNr5JRB3e8yh5
transaction
57f6dedf89f968c1a01a03e58ed93226f4b689f6c7782128d65c8fd8892dcd17
spent
true